Safe secure housing
Opportunity House provides a safe place for residents to feel comfortable, monitored by staff 24/7.
Drug-free environment
Fostering a clean environment, free of alcohol and drugs to provide a pathway to productive lifestyles.
Comprehensive case management
Building trust with a dedicated Case Manager to help set and achieve personal goals, including family reconciliation, financial savings plans, and more!
Life-skills training
Residents participate in daily group meetings on topics such as personal finance, parenting, and recovery support in order to build important life skills needed to sustain a healthy life outside of the shelter.
Donation funded
The shelter is largely funded through community donations and local charities, including sales at Opportunity House Thrift Store.
